The Toyota repair market in and around Richlandtown, PA, is characterized by a few highly competent independent shops and established service centers in neighboring towns like Quakertown. Due to Richlandtown's small size, residents typically travel a short distance (5-15 miles) for specialized automotive care. The competition is moderate, with a focus on building long-term customer trust rather than price undercutting. The average quality is high, as the shops that survive in this market do so through reputation. Pricing is competitive with regional averages; expect diagnostic fees in the $120-$150 range, with labor rates typically between $110-$140 per hour. For highly specialized services like hybrid battery repair or complex electrical diagnostics, the independent specialist (Japanese Auto Specialist) often commands a premium justified by their specific expertise.

Given our local climate with snowy winters and salted roads, common repairs for Richlandtown Toyota owners often include brake system servicing, suspension component replacement due to potholes, and addressing undercarriage rust. For older models, issues like oil consumption in certain 4-cylinder engines or dashboard cracks are also frequent concerns we address.
Look for a shop with ASE-certified technicians who have specific Toyota training and who use quality OEM or OEM-equivalent parts. In the Richlandtown and Upper Bucks area, check for strong local reputations built over many years, read community-focused reviews, and ask if the shop provides detailed digital vehicle inspections with photos.
Toyota repairs are generally very competitive and often more affordable than many European brands, due to good parts availability and straightforward engineering. For common maintenance and repairs, local independent shops in Richlandtown usually offer significant savings compared to dealership labor rates while maintaining quality.

Our rural roads and winter conditions mean you should adhere strictly to, or even shorten, intervals for tire rotations, brake inspections, and undercarriage washes to combat rust. Frequent temperature changes also make monitoring battery health, coolant strength, and tire pressure especially important for year-round reliability.
